Vicodin is classified as a controlled substance. Obtaining it without a proper prescription issued by a qualified healthcare provider is against the law and poses serious risks.

It's imperative to understand that Vicodin, like many potent medications, can have severe side effects if misused or abused. Utilizing prescription painkillers without medical supervision can lead to addiction and long-term health complications.
